acta ethologica publishes empirical and theoretical research papers, short communications, commentaries, reviews and book reviews as well as methods papers in the field of ethology and related disciplines, with a strong concentration on the behavior biology of humans and other animals. The journal places special emphasis on studies integrating proximate (mechanisms, development) and ultimate (function, evolution) levels in the analysis of behavior. Aspects of particular interest include: adaptive plasticity of behavior, inter-individual and geographic variations in behavior, mechanisms underlying behavior, evolutionary processes and functions of behavior, and many other topics. acta ethologica is an official journal of ISPA, CRL and the Portuguese Ethological Society (SPE) Publishes empirical and theoretical research papers, short communications, commentaries, Reviews, book reviews and methods papers on the behavior biology of humans and other animalsFocuses primarily on results of field studiesPlaces special emphasis on studies integrating proximate and ultimate levels in the analysis of behavior It has an SJR impact factor of 0,412.
